According to this form, completed by Konjufca on 26 August, the second most voted man of Vetevendosje Movement in the 6 October elections, owns two residences of over 100 square metres in the Kalabria neighbourhood in Pristina.
Both these real estates, the Vetevendosje Movement member has declared them property registered in his name, writes Insander.
But the loan, which he has stated to the forms submitted to the Central Election Commission, Konjufca had not stated on the property declaration forms at the Anti-Corruption Agency several months ago.
Konjufca won another deputy mandate in the 6 October parliamentary elections in Kosovo.
He has served as an MP in the last four legislatures, as for the first time in the Kosovo Assembly he had secured in 2010.
